Which of the following reforms did both Frederick II of Prussia and Maria Theresa of Austria make to
their countries?
(1 point)
outlawed serfdom
funded public schools
allowed religious freedom
protected freedom of speech

All Answers 1

Answered by GPT-5 mini AI
Funded public schools.

Both monarchs promoted and expanded state-run education (Maria Theresa instituted compulsory primary schooling and funding; Frederick II supported and reformed Prussian schools). They did not both outlaw serfdom, allow broad religious freedom, or protect freedom of speech.
